Catenary-like pattern of stretching DNA molecules: experiments models
- 1. Chiense Academy of Sciences, Shanghai (China). Shanghai Inst. of Nuclear Research
Description
It was verified that the authors' 's-suspension bridge' model may be not only responsible for catenary-like patterns of DNA molecules which were formed in authors experiments, but also for catenary-like patterns of DNA molecules in literature
